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hartlebury to Mauldeth Road start from as little as £13.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hartlebury to Mauldeth Road start from £53.50 one way, or £54.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hartlebury to Mauldeth Road are available for £63.40 one way, or £125.80 return

Facilities at Hartlebury Station

Despite its quaint size, Hartlebury train station is equipped with essential ticket purchasing and collection facilities. There's no ticket office, but ticket machines are available to ensure you can secure your travel easily. While smartcards aren't an option here, you can collect tickets bought online at the station. Be mindful that accessible ticket machines are not available.

Accessibility is a focus, with step-free access to all platforms, although some paths might be steep. The station lacks some conveniences like waiting rooms and accessible toilets but has a seating area for passengers. If you need assistance, help points are available, and conductors are on hand to provide boarding assistance. It’s important to plan ahead as there is no staff assistance service available.

Facilities and Services

Mauldeth Road station provides a variety of basic amenities, making travel straightforward and accessible. The station houses a ticket office that opens from 07:10 to 13:50 on weekdays, and 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ting pre-bought tickets. However, there are no accessible ticket machines. For those needing assistance, staff are available on site with their hours stretching longer on weekdays compared to Saturdays. If faced with any difficulties, a customer help point is available, offering a reassuring point of contact.

Accessibility considerations have been made, with partial step-free access and a scooter-friendly environment. However, be aware of some limitations: there are no accessible toilets, waiting rooms, or ticket barriers, and wheelchairs are not available. Car parking is available 24 hours a day, managed by Northern, although spaces are limited to 20 and none are specifically designed for accessibility. Refreshing refreshments or shopping experiences aren't part of the offering here, so plan accordingly.

Onward Travel Options

Once you've arrived at Mauldeth Road station, moving on to other modes of transport is refreshingly simple. Rail replacement services ensure no disruption leaves travelers stranded, with strategic bus stops connecting Mauldeth Road to Manchester Airport and Manchester Piccadilly. Regular buses run to destinations like Stockport, East Didsbury, and Manchester city center, accessible from stops on both sides of Mauldeth Road – call Busline at 0871 200 2233 for detailed routes and schedules. Taxi services can be arranged, offering a convenient option for travelers preferring a direct route; more details can be found [here](https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you).

A direct train to Manchester International Airport takes approximately 15 minutes, making it an ideal choice for catching flights. While no bicycle hire facilities are directly available at the station, other locations in the vicinity might offer these services if you're keen on cycling through Manchester.
